Table 2 Microanatomical characteristic of tissue collected from different organs

From: Toxicity evaluation of cordycepin and its delivery system for sustained in vitro anti-lung cancer activity

Organ

Microanatomical characteristic of tissue

Percentage of characteristic founded (%)

p value; Chi-square

Group

0.25 mg/ml

1 mg/ml

Control

Liver

Macrovesicularsteatosis

33.3 (3/9)

0 (0/7)

37.5 (3/8)

0.189

Sinusoidal congestion

100 (9/9)

100 (7/7)

100 (8/8)

-

Pyknotic nuclei

88.9 (8/9)

0 (0/7)*

62.5 (5/8)

0.002

Glycogen storage

77.8 (7/9)

71.4 (5/7)

75 (6/8)

0.959

Lymphocyte aggregation

11.1 (1/9)

57.1 (4/7)*

0 (0/8)

0.016

Spleen

Normal

100 (9/9)

100 (7/7)

100 (8/8)

-

Kidney

Normal

100 (9/9)

100 (7/7)

100 (8/8)

-

Testis

Normal

100 (9/9)

100 (7/7)

100 (8/8)

-

Brain

Normal

100 (9/9)

100 (7/7)

100 (8/8)

-

  1. The liver, spleen, kidney, testis, and brain of rats fed with cordycepin every day for consecutive 30 days; *indicates significant difference compared to control (p < 0.05).
